There are several laboratories, including Laboratory of Information Technologies in Systems Analysis and Modeling. It works on :
System analysis, poly-model multi-objective efficiency estimation in complex technical-organizational systems (CTOS), development of methodological and methodical basics for the theory of CTOS structure-dynamics control at different phases of system's life cycle.
The other laboratory is Research Group for Information Technologies in Education. It deals with information technologies in education and the development of computer science-educational center of SPIIRAS.
